What works for me – student submission

A way that I do self-care is through hobbies I enjoy; I think it is important to take time out of the day to do something I enjoy in a day. In addition, putting aside time in a day for self-care, no matter the day can help to build a routine and can be really needed on those days when everything seems hard. Whether it be my hobby, something calming like a bath, or watching a show or one of my comfort shows, I have found this to be really helpful in getting me back on track.

I also recommend if you don’t know yet what works for you, trying new techniques to see how they work, through trial and error, is a really important part of a self care and mental health journey.

Something that has really helped me as well is reading in general; I find that reading is really calming for me because no matter the feelings or need for comfort, there is a book out there that can help me ease my mind. Concerning self-help books, however, some feel helpless, like they don’t help in finding what works or give any insight on specific issues; there are some that I find comforting. A book that kind of helped me to better understand myself was called “The Mountain is You: Transforming Self-Sabotage into Self-mastery. By Brianna Wiest.”
